Just installed Webmin "fresh" 1.910 on an Ubuntu 18.04.LTS system. I used a iptables.up.rules file from another fairly similar system with iptables-restore, but it didn't look quite right in Webmin. So then I used Webmin to "Reset firewall" and told it to use the "Block all except ports used for virtual hosting, on interface" defaults. Everything looked fine except for two "ACCEPT" rules that were at the beginning of the list. Their comments indicate that these were the rules to accept established/related. The only problem is that there were *no* paramters/conditions set for the rule(s), so they basically ended up being "blank ACCEPT" rules. I've never seen this in Webmin before, but I can repeat it at will by choosing to "reset firewall". -joho |
